[7] ==Uses== PHMG was used in Russia to disinfect hospitals [5] and from 2001 on, it was widely used in South Korea as a disinfectant to prevent microbial contamination in household humidifiers. [8] PHMG was "originally marketed for cleaning a humidifier's water tank but instead used by the public as a water additive to suppress microbial growth."
